查詢

oci_free_statement()函式—用法及示例

「 釋放一個已經準備好的語句控制代碼 」


函式名稱:oci_free_statement()

函式描述:oci_free_statement() 函式用於釋放一個已經準備好的語句控制代碼。

適用版本:PHP 5, PHP 7

語法:bool oci_free_statement ( resource $statement )

引數:

  • $statement: 必需,一個有效的語句控制代碼,通常透過 oci_parse() 函式返回。

返回值:

  • 成功時返回 true,失敗時返回 false。

示例:

// 連線到 Oracle 資料庫
$conn = oci_connect('username', 'password', 'localhost/XE');

// 準備一個語句控制代碼
$stid = oci_parse($conn, 'SELECT * FROM employees');

// 執行查詢
oci_execute($stid);

// 釋放語句控制代碼
oci_free_statement($stid);

// 關閉資料庫連線
oci_close($conn);

在上面的示例中,首先使用 oci_connect() 函式連線到 Oracle 資料庫。然後,使用 oci_parse() 函式準備一個查詢語句的語句控制代碼。接下來,使用 oci_execute() 函式執行查詢。最後,使用 oci_free_statement() 函式釋放語句控制代碼,以便在不再需要時釋放資源。最後,使用 oci_close() 函式關閉資料庫連線。

請注意,釋放語句控制代碼是一個良好的程式設計習慣,可以避免記憶體洩漏和資源浪費。

補充糾錯
下一個函式: oci_free_descriptor()函式
熱門PHP函式
分享連結